Cleric counts role models of new world order for Muslim states

Secretary General of World Forum for Proximity of Islamic Schools of Thought has called on the Muslim countries to launch Islamic societies’ union as part of the new world order.

Hujjat-ul-Islam Hamid Shahriari, in his remarks at commemoration ceremony for late Ayatollah Taskhiri enumerated the role model of Iran, Saudi Arabia and Turkey as sustained examples of leading the world of Islam, reported Taqrib News Agency (TNA).
 
He referred to the global developments brought by the new world order and said,” Three sustained examples are leading in the world of Islam the first being the model of Turkey, followed by the example of Saudi Arabia and then the model of Wilayat Faqi’h (jurisprudence).”
 
Top cleric hailed the third model for its successful achievement of its objectives and also confrontation with Israeli regime and arrogant powers.
 
The fourth scientific meeting on harbingers of peace and Islamic unity was held on the biography, ideology and thoughts of Ayatollah Mohammad Ali Taskhiri.
 
The meeting was jointly held by World Forum for Proximity of Islamic Schools of Thought, Humanities Research Center and Organization of Islamic Promotion.
